Vulvitis is mainly divided into acute vulvitis and chronic vulvitis. The following is a detailed introduction to the specific symptoms:

1. Symptoms of acute vulvitis

1. Female patients will first feel discomfort in the vulva after suffering from vulvitis, followed by itching and pain, or a burning sensation. At the same time, the skin and mucous membranes of the vulva may have varying degrees of swelling and congestion. In severe cases, large areas of erosion and eczema may form, accompanied by painful urination and sexual intercourse.

2. When folliculitis occurs in the female vulva, the vulva may become severely swollen and painful due to the occurrence of abscesses, and then a furuncle may form.

3. If female patients do not receive timely treatment, severe vulvitis will develop into ulcers accompanied by fever, swollen inguinal lymph nodes and general discomfort. The base of the ulcer is grayish yellow, with obvious congestion and edema. It can heal on its own but often recurs, which is also one of the symptoms of acute vulvitis.

2. Symptoms of chronic vulvitis

1. The main symptoms of vulvitis are vulvar itching, thickening, roughness, and cracking of the skin, which may also be accompanied by painful urination or sexual intercourse.

2. In the early stage, there will be discomfort in the vulva. As the disease progresses, itching and pain in the vulva will gradually appear. Some patients may experience swelling and congestion of the vulva.
